Repair Costs - The typical cost for concrete repair services can range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age and project size. Small cracks or surface repairs t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s or structural fixes are more expensive.
Material Expenses - Material costs for concrete repair vary based on the type and amount needed, usually between $2 and $6 per square foot. Larger areas or specialized materials like epoxy or fiber-reinforced concrete can increase overall expenses.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for concrete rep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total costs influenced by project complexity and duration. Larger or more intricate repairs may require additional labor hours, raising the overall price.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include surface preparation, removal of damaged concrete, or finishing work, often adding $200 to $800 to the total. These charges depend on the specific repair requirements and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ete repair services are available? Local service providers offer a range of repairs including crack filling, surface leveling, spall repair, and structural reinforcement to address various concrete issues.
How do I know if my concrete needs repair? Signs such as cracking, sinking, uneven surfaces, or visible deterioration indicate that concrete may require professional assessment and repair.
What causes concrete to deteriorate? Common causes include exposure to mo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, ground movement, and heavy loads, which can lead to cracking and surface damage.
How long does concrete rep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the type of repair, but most projects can be completed within a few hours to a few days.
